Technical Mathematics 1A
Technical Mathematics 1A
Two Rivers High School - 0.5 Math Credits
Lakeshore Technical College - 3 technical college credits
Course Description/Program Outcomes: Students will be able to solve problems that involve linear equations; graphs; percent; proportions; measurement systems; computational geometry; and right triangle trigonometry. Emphasis will be placed on the application of skills to technical problems.
Students have the option to earn both high school math credit AND 3 technical college credits because they will take a course taught by a high school instructor where a “Transcripted Credit Articulation Agreement” exists for the course between the high school and technical college. Students must earn a letter grade of A, B, or C on LTC’s grading scale in order to earn college credit for the course. All students taking a transcripted credit class will have an LTC transcript.
